The Ossuary
The Ossuary occupies the decommissioned lower level of a Tier 1 municipal water recycling station beneath the Kessler Stack, a residential megablock in the deepest Shelf. The space is raw concrete and corroded pipe — walls dripping with condensation, the ceiling a dense tangle of reclaimed cable and salvaged lighting rigs that pulse in time with the music. Capacity is rarely counted; estimates run between 200 and 400 depending on how desperate the crowd is. There are no seats. The floor is uneven. Two people have died here from structural accidents, and both are considered martyrs of the scene.

The Ossuary has no fixed location in the traditional sense — it occupies the same physical space, but access points rotate on a two-week cycle, communicated through encrypted mesh bursts to trusted contacts. Corporate security has raided the water station three times since 2208; each time they found nothing but old pipe and standing water. The venue's sound system is entirely custom-built from salvaged industrial hardware and consumer-grade neural broadcast emitters, producing a bass response that the regulars describe as 'feeling like the building is swallowing you.' Notable events include the 2211 debut performance of Rua Negra, which drew a crowd so large the venue's structural supports were visibly flexing by the third set.

cultural impactThe Ossuary is widely credited with incubating the Shelf noise movement's second wave in the 2210s. Its reputation as a space where no corporate ears reach has made it a site of genuine political speech — manifestos have been read here, labor actions coordinated, grief processed publicly in ways that the upper tiers have no equivalent for. It exists at the intersection of music and necessity, and its continued survival despite repeated raids has given it a near-mythological status among Shelf communities across the Great Lakes corridor.
